Only joking...when scalding the maggots do not leave them in the hot water for to long because this will bleach the colour out of them and make then stretch although that is not a problem here because you are using them for feed bait....another way is to remove the air from the bag and put it in the freezer over night but remember to remove the air other wise they will come back to life after a wile when thawed out

hi cavanman,

just some tips that you may or may not of had.

i caught 11 8lb+ bream in one day on this technique:

size 8 hook
10lb line(can use less but why when theres a chance of a real gooden'!!?)
about 3 RED maggots on the hook at a time
ground baited little and often with mixed maggots and method
fished about 10meters out

hope this helps mate
